    • A circuit for controlling illumination means in a display includes illumination means arranged in a series-connection that are supplied with an essentially constant current. For individually controlling the illumination means, switches are provided for bypassing individual illumination means, maintaining the essentially constant current in the series-connection. The switches are floating with respect to a ground potential. A coupling means is thus provided for proper control of the switches. In a development of the invention a floating local power supply is provided with each illumination means and switch for operating the switch. The local power supply is, in one embodiment, powered by the control signal that is used for controlling the bypass switch. In another embodiment provision is made for supplying power to the floating local power supply. A driving method according to the embodiments of the circuit is also described.

    • The present invention concerns a device for generating a rectangular sustain voltage between the line scanning electrodes (Y) and the line common electrodes (Z) of luminous cells in a plasma panel. The device includes a first sustain amplifier (11 ) connected to the line scanning electrode (Y) of the cells to produce the transitions of the first sustain voltage signal, and a second sustain amplifier (13) connected to the line common electrode (Z) of the cells to produce the transitions of the second sustain voltage signal. It also includes an insulated voltage supply circuit which is connected directly to the line scanning electrodes (Y) and to the line common electrodes (Z) of the cells in order to hold the end-of-transition voltage on said line scanning electrodes (Y) and said line common electrodes (Z).
